Paris 1872, printing house of Rouge, Dunon and Fresne. 13x21 cm, pp. 36, softcover. Good condition (small tears at the spine).
Report of the period from January 1, 1870 to January 1, 1872. The Society of Scientific Aid was founded in Paris in 1868 to run a scholarship campaign to support Polish young people studying in exile. Among those active in it were Agaton Giller, Jan Dzialynski, Karol Ruprecht, Seweryn Goszczynski.
